Centre Approves Major Development Package for Himachal Pradesh; Projects Worth Over Rs. 300 Crore Get Green Signal.
Shimla:
The Central Government has extended a significant development boost to Himachal Pradesh, approving multiple key infrastructure projects, including Rs. 93.55 crore for special repairs of embankments along sensitive stretches of National Highway-154A. The move is expected to provide major relief to disaster-affected regions and ensure safer, smoother travel routes.

Major Projects Approved Under CRIF
Ajay Rana announced that three important road and bridge projects have been sanctioned under the Central Road and Infrastructure Fund (CRIF), facilitated by the efforts of state leaders and the Central Government. The approved projects include:
- Rs. 137.40 crore for the reconstruction of the Mandi–Gaggal–Chail Chowk–Janjheli Road
- Rs. 48.69 crore for the upgradation of the Jejon Mod–Tahliwal Link Road
- Rs. 28.35 crore for the construction of a 110-metre double-lane motorable bridge between Pirdi and Talogi over the Beas River in Kullu
